River object - LowLODDistance causing river to dissapear
by David McDonald · in Torque 3D Professional · 09/11/2009 (4:25 am) · 10 replies
- Placed a river via the river editor
- When zooming in to fiddle with the details the segment close to the camera vanishes completely (In editor and in game)
- Changing the LowLODDistance from the default of 50 to 1 corrects the problem (Until I get to 1 unit away).
- Cannot see higher detail of the river to adjust flow etc.

As a slightly related issue here.With our rivers placed and running down a slope we see no current as in the cherry blossom demo and the river editor tutorial.
Is this a configuration/settings issue that I am just too blind to see or have I forgotten to enable a feature etc.
#8
09/28/2009 (4:24 am)
That is controlled by the ripple/wave fields ( same as for other WaterObjects ). The speed of the river waves/ripples is constant throughout the river, it is not aware of its own 'slope'.
